User Experience Insights on W3 Information Sites

Delving into the realm of web design, it's crucial to examine the psychological factors that influence user satisfaction on W3 information sites. These platforms serve as gateways to knowledge, and crafting an effective structure is paramount for fostering a positive user journey. By utilizing design principles grounded in psychology, we can enhance the way users interact with information.

  • One key aspect is the concept of cognitive load, which refers to the amount of mental effort required to process information. Web designers should strive to alleviate cognitive load by presenting content in a clear, concise, and organized manner.
  • Visual cues play a significant role in guiding user attention. Strategic use of color, typography, and imagery can help users explore the site more effectively.
  • Trust is essential for building a strong connection with users. By incorporating elements that convey trustworthiness, such as reviews, we can increase user confidence in the information presented.

Navigating Cognitive Load in Web 3.0 Information Design

As the metaverse and decentralized applications emerge, understanding cognitive load becomes paramount for effective information design in Web 3.0. Users must analyze complex data structures, navigate decentralized networks, and make informed decisions within virtual environments. To minimize cognitive overload, designers must emphasize on clear visual hierarchies, intuitive structure, and concise communication. By employing these principles, we can create immersive and engaging Web 3.0 experiences that empower users to confidently interact in the evolving digital landscape.

Estimating Women's Mental Health Outcomes: A Computational Approach

Computational models are emerging as powerful tools for assessing women's mental health outcomes. These models leverage vast data pools to identify patterns and predict future trends in conditions such as anxiety. By incorporating indicators like demographic information, daily habits, and medical history, these models aim to optimize our understanding of women's mental well-being.

Researchers are actively constructing innovative computational models that utilize deep learning algorithms to generate accurate predictions. These models hold immense potential for tailored interventions, early detection of mental health issues, and ultimately, enhancing the lives of women worldwide.
